Slack time, used in Program Evaluation and Review Technique (PERT), denotes how much an activity can be delayed beyond its earliest start date, without causing any problems in the completion of the project by its due date.Also known as float, slack time is applicable only to those activities which do not lie on the critical path of the PERT chart. Other Important Terms Lag - Inserted waiting time between tasks Free Slack - Available delay time without impacting start of successor Total Slack - Amount of time a task can be delayed without delaying project completion date Project Slack - Amount of time a project can be delayed without impacting completion dates imposed by client . Free float refers to the amount of time that a task can be delayed without having an impact on the deadline of the next task. Negative float, also known as negative slack, is the amount of time beyond a project's scheduled completion that a task within the project requires. In project management, float or slack is the amount of time that a task in a project network can be delayed without causing a delay to: subsequent tasks ("free float") project completion date ("total float"). Slack is the amount of time that an activity can be delayed past its earliest start or earliest finish without delaying the project. Description The Total Slack field contains the amount of time a task's finish date can be delayed without delaying the project's finish date..
